Description: Gooer is a Remote Desktop service provider. It allows you to access your remote computer just as if you were sitting directly in front of it. You can remote access your home or office computer via web browser or mobile phone. You also do not need worry about the NAT or firewall. Gooer will let you access your PC from anywhere. Gooer also support File Transfer and Remote Printing that can let you easily use local print and file system.
Gooer service is safe for our customers. It provided security and authentication between web client, server and host.
Gooer also support all Java powered mobile phones,Symbian mobiles and Wireless device that support Java (j2me) MIDP 2.0. You can access your remote PC using them when you do not have Laptop.
For the computer with the Service (the one that you will access remotely):
- Windows XP , Windows 2000 , Windows 2003 or Vista
- Always on" stable Internet connection (DSL, Cable, ISDN, etc.)
- Minimum of Pentium 450 with 128 MB of RAM
For the local computer (the one that you will use to access the Service):
- any OS with any web browser that support JRE
- Minimum of Pentium 300 with 64 MB of RAM
- Internet connection
For the local Mobile((the mobile device that you will use to access the Service): )
- Java powered mobile phones; Symbian mobiles; Wireless device that support Java (j2me) MIDP 2.0
- support GPRS, EDGE,3G technology or WLAN
Gooer also support File Transfer and Remote Printing
- File Transfer: Copy files quickly between local and remote PCs
